Why MMAIATEX is expanding its English articles

International buyers often begin with a short request such as "explosion-proof junction box," "Ex cable gland" or "equipment for Zone 1." Those phrases identify a broad need, but they do not provide enough information to approve a product.

A responsible enquiry may also need to identify the destination country, hazardous-area classification, required Equipment Protection Level, gas or dust group, temperature requirement, ambient range, protection concept, electrical duty, cable construction and required documents.

The MMAIATEX English series is intended to help buyers understand these questions before they request a quotation. It also helps readers separate three different decisions:

  1. Finding a relevant product category
  2. Determining whether a product could suit the application
  3. Verifying whether the exact model has the required current documentation

No article can complete the second or third decision without project information and model-specific evidence.

How the articles support a better enquiry

A buyer can use the series in the following order:

  1. Confirm the final installation country and applicable project rules.
  2. Obtain the approved hazardous-area classification from the responsible project team.
  3. Identify the atmosphere, zone, EPL or category, group, temperature and ambient range.
  4. Use the technical guides to prepare cable, enclosure, terminal and environmental details.
  5. Request current documents for the exact model and configuration.
  6. Verify the documents through official systems and qualified project personnel.

This process reduces avoidable assumptions. It does not guarantee that a suitable product is available, and it does not replace engineering review.

Editorial principles used for the series

The articles use an answer-first format, descriptive headings and direct responses to buyer questions. Important compliance statements link to official IEC, IECEx or European Union sources.

The series also follows these controls:

  • General education is separated from product-specific claims.
  • Certification is never inferred from a photograph or category page.
  • Website text is not presented as a replacement for a certificate.
  • Current official sources are preferred for scheme and standards information.
  • Safety limitations and the need for competent review remain visible.

These controls are important because hazardous-area terminology can appear precise even when the product identity, certificate scope or installation conditions have not been verified.
